Promoters and individuals planning events where alcohol will be sold this holiday season are being reminded to apply early for their liquor licences to avoid delays.
Applications must be submitted online at liquorlicence.gov.bb, where persons can choose between a Special Occasion Liquor Licence, valid for events lasting 24 hours or less, or a Seasonal Liquor Licence, which covers a 90-day period and can be used for multiple events.
Payments can be made online through EZpay+ via the applicant’s liquor licence account, or in person at post offices across the island. For timely approval, applicants are being advised to submit their requests at least four working days before their scheduled event.
Persons needing assistance with the application process may contact the Liquor Licence Authority of the Department of Commerce and Consumer Affairs at 535-7019, 535-7011, 535-7015 or 535-7042, or visit its offices at the Energy Division, Country Road, St. Michael, between 9 a.m. and 3 p.m.
